Why Replacement Matters:

  • The main crankshaft bearings support the crankshaft while maintaining a thin film of pressurised engine oil between the bearing surface and the crankshaft journals. They are subjected to enormous combustion loads, constant rotational forces and continuous lubrication. Over time, normal wear, contamination or insufficient lubrication can damage the bearing surfaces, increasing bearing clearances and reducing oil pressure.
  • Worn main bearings can lead to excessive crankshaft movement, reduced lubrication efficiency and accelerated wear of critical engine components. If left unresolved, bearing failure can result in severe crankshaft damage and complete engine failure.

What Do Engine Shell Bearings Do?

Shell bearings create a low-friction interface between rotating and stationary engine parts, allowing the crankshaft and connecting rods to spin freely under heavy load.

Core Functions:

  • Support crankshaft and con rod rotation with minimal friction.
  • Maintain correct oil clearance for consistent lubrication.
  • Absorb and distribute combustion forces evenly across the crank journals.
  • Reduce wear and vibration, enhancing engine longevity.

Without these bearings, metal-to-metal contact would occur, resulting in catastrophic engine failure.

Why Do Engine Bearings Fail?

Even high-performance bearings wear over time, particularly when exposed to heat, contamination, or oil pressure issues. Failure can lead to increased friction, engine noise, or complete bearing seizure.

Common Causes of Bearing Failure Include:

  • Oil starvation or low oil pressure, causing direct metal contact.
  • Contaminated or degraded engine oil, introducing abrasive particles.
  • Improper clearance or installation, leading to uneven wear.
  • Overheating from excessive load or detonation.
  • Bearing fatigue or material degradation after prolonged use.

Signs of bearing wear include knocking sounds, low oil pressure warnings, or visible scoring on bearing surfaces. Immediate replacement is critical to prevent damage to the crankshaft and engine block.
